Title: "Birbal's Starry Solution"
Emperor Akbar, enamored by Birbal's wit, found himself surrounded by nobles consumed by envy. Seeking to banish Birbal from the court, they persuaded the emperor to pose an impossible question. Certain that Birbal would falter, they anticipated his banishment.
Akbar, intrigued, asked Birbal, "How many stars adorn the sky?"
Undaunted, Birbal requested a few days to unravel the celestial mystery. Days later, he arrived at the court with a sheep. Confounding all, he declared, "I have counted the stars, Your Majesty."
Birbal asserted that the number of stars equaled the count of hairs on the sheep. Amused, Akbar decided to play along and challenged the disgruntled nobles to verify Birbal's claim by counting the sheep's hair.
As the nobles struggled with their futile task, Birbal's cleverness unfolded. Akbar, witnessing the absurdity of the situation, burst into hearty laughter. Impressed by Birbal's ingenuity, he not only spared him from banishment but rewarded him handsomely, leaving the jealous nobles to ponder the depth of wit possessed by the man they sought to remove.

**Title: Birbal's Starry Solution**
**Once upon a time in the court of Emperor Akbar, a brilliant and witty man named Birbal held a special place in the emperor's heart. However, his intelligence made the other nobles envious, and they hatched a plan to get him banished.**
**One day, the jealous nobles approached Akbar and suggested a scheme. They advised Akbar to ask Birbal an extremely difficult question, believing that he wouldn't be able to answer it. The punishment for failure would be banishment from the kingdom.**
**Intrigued, Akbar decided to play along. He asked Birbal, "How many stars are there in the sky?" Birbal, aware of the cunning plan, requested some days to come up with an answer.**
**Finally, Birbal returned to the court with a sheep. He confidently told Akbar, "I have counted the stars, and the number is the same as the number of hairs on this sheep."**
**Amused and intrigued, Akbar couldn't help but laugh. The nobles, caught off guard, were left speechless. Birbal, ever the clever one, invited them to count the hairs if they doubted his answer.**
**Emperor Akbar, thoroughly entertained and impressed, not only spared Birbal from banishment but also rewarded him handsomely. The jealous nobles learned a valuable lesson about the wit and wisdom of Birbal. From that day forward, Birbal's reputation in the court shone even brighter, like the countless stars he had humorously counted.**✨
